Okay someone posted awhile back about what bags to use to put in hair clips ect.
I went to the dollar store and bought baby throw away diaper bags. They are a nice color pink and smell good as well. You get 75 bags in a box. The little bags are ideal and can hold about 4 to 5 bows. People love the smell.

This popped back up so I thought I'd share another idea
Today I went to the dollar tree and bought 2 packs of 25 count Christmas "treat bags." They are clear cello with gingerbread cookies on them. I thought they would be handy for SMALL purchases instead of using my kind of pricey hot pink pretty ones.
Then I went to Walmart and they had 20 ct. Christmas Cello bags that were more in my colors, so I bought 2 of those too. I'll probably use the Wal-mart ones 1st (since they are cuter) and have the gingerbread ones for back up.
$4 for nearly 100 bags, that's a bargain to me! I think I pay $35ish for 250 of the hot pink bags... :-P
